FNC: “A pair of North Carolina Republicans are introducing a bill on Wednesday to prevent federal funding from going to a recent Department of Education proposal or any other proposal aimed at teaching critical race theory in schools. Freshman Rep. Madison Cawthorn, R-N.C., and House Education and Labor Committee ranking member Virginia Foxx, R-N.C., are planning to introduce the Protecting Equality and Civics Education (PEACE) Act on Wednesday, Fox News has learned. The PEACE Act amends the Consolidated Appropriations Act to prohibit federal funds from going to programs that push for critical race theory in schools.”
